Red Herring to cease publication

RCH Media will cease publishing its flagship magazine, The Red Herring, according to a notice posted on the publication's Web site. Red Herring covered the Silicon Valley venture capital community for 10 years, riding high on the Internet boom but ultimately failing to weather the bust.

"I thought the worst was over, and the company was back on solid ground. But the advertising market remains sluggish, and our investors decided they had had enough," Red Herring co-founder Tony Perkins wrote in a note Monday.
